#2d367e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2d367e is composed of 17.6% red, 21.2%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.3% cyan, 57.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 233.3 degrees, a saturation of 47.4% and a lightness of 33.5%. #2d367e color hex could be obtained by blending #5a6cfc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#2d367e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04040a is the darkest color, while #fbfb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2d367e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#545557 is the less saturated color, while #0617a5 is the most saturated one.
